Job Title: Quality Assistant Manager
Location: HMP Belmarsh
Salary: Up to GBP35,000 per annum
Contract Type: Permanent
Role Overview:
As Assistant Manager, you will play a key role in leading and developing a team approach to delivering high–quality education services to learners within HMP Belmarsh. Working closely with the Education Manager, you will oversee site performance and contribute to curriculum development, quality assurance, and contract delivery. Acting as part of the senior management team, you will ensure provision exceeds partner and learner expectations in line with our ethos of Improving People's Lives. You will also deputise for the Education Manager when required.
Key Responsibilities:
Lead on curriculum management and quality assurance within your area. Support the Education Manager in day–to–day operations, including learner induction, class allocation, and conduct management. Maintain and develop positive internal and external partnerships for the benefit of learners. Drive innovation and problem–solving among tutors to raise standards and meet performance targets (recruitment, retention, achievement, satisfaction). Set and monitor staff targets to ensure contractual obligations are met and exceeded. Manage teaching and support staff using PeoplePlus HR strategies to maximise learner success and provision efficiency. Attend meetings, cascade information, and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ives. Essential/Desirable Criteria:
Level 5 or above Teaching Qualification. Level 4 Award in Internal Quality Assurance (or willingness to work towards). Evidence of continuous professional development and ability to lead an achievement–focused team. Strong leadership and staff management skills with a persuasive and supportive approach. Ability to identify and implement curriculum improvements aligned to learner and employer needs. Innovative, proactive, and highly communicative with strong influencing skills. Clear understanding of the OFSTED Education Inspection Framework (EIF). Significant teaching experience and successful track record in managing curriculum development, quality systems, and staff performance to improve learner outcomes.
